If it were me, I'd send an email to the hostel letting them know an approximate arrival time and they can make a note near your name.

While the front desk will likely have coverage late in the evening, most guests will have checked in much earlier than you. An email will clear up any confusion in the off-chance your hostel is running near full capacity and someone at the front desk thinks you are a no-show and decides to give your bunks away to a couple of last minute walk-ins. Better safe than sorry and having to try and find accommodation at another hostel late at night.

Keep a print out of the email you send to the hostel (and any response you might get back from the hostel) with you so you can show it to the front desk if there is any problem upon your arrival.
